WebIntroduction. Normally, the amount of total body water should be balanced through the ingestion and elimination of water: ins and outs. To ensure this balance, as a nurse, you may need to track and record all fluid intake and output on an intake and output sheet, commonly known as an I&O sheet. WebHere is a list of foods to consider when you’re counting fluid intake: Coffee and tea; Gelatin; Ice chips or cubes; Ice cream; Juice; Milk and milk substitutes; Popsicles; Sherbet; … WebA helpful strategy for measuring ice chips is to record them as half the volume of the container they are in. So, if a patient consumes all of the ice chips in a 120 mL cup, record his input for ice chips as 60 mL. Tube …
